Mobileye, an Israeli autonomous vehicle startup acquired by Intel, is putting its self-driving system to the ultimate test: the mean streets of New York City.

At an event this week, Intel announced that its Mobileye self-driving cars were approved to drive through NYC streets. It's the only autonomous vehicle testing permit-holder in the city. It's also the first company to have a dedicated testing program in the country's most populous municipality.
